Part 100.10 Regulations Parents of, or persons in parental relation to, compulsory school age children have the legal right to instruct their children at home. Nonpublic school administrators must require that batboys and bat girls participating in baseball and softball competitions wear protective headgear when on the field and the game is in play. Private schools offering instruction deemed substantially equivalent to public schools must offer instruction in highway safety and traffic regulations, including bicycle safety. Private schools are eligible to apply to the office of mental health for education grants for the identification and treatment of adolescents who are at high risk for suicide. If there are reasonable grounds to believe that the home instruction program is not in compliance with these regulations, the superintendent of schools can conduct or send a representative for a home visit after providing three days written notice. Nonpublic school vehicle operators may apply for reimbursement of the motor vehicle tax expended exclusively in education-related activities. Smoking is prohibited in all private schools and on school grounds, with an exception for adult faculty and staff members, who may be permitted to smoke in designated areas during non-school hours.
